If you are going to live in a large metropolitan area.
Verizon FiOS offers 50Mbps.
AT&T has U-Verse but it is only maxed out at 18Mbps
Reason being…they do not want to spend the money to make what “dark fiber” they already have at the poles useable for residential use.
Not to mention a majority of the fiber is FFTN instead of FFTH.
